[Bug 810221] [NEW] Video output stops on real root after July 12 udev changes

In Ubuntu Oneiric, since the July 11/12 udev, initramfs-tools, basefiles
(/var/run to /run ) changes, plymouth flickers to black, causing all
video output to cut off ("no signal" report from monitors) until
/etc/init/plymouth-upstart-bridge.conf runs, restarting video output.

If /etc/init/plymouth-upstart-bridge.conf  is disabled as a test,  video
does not resume at all, showing this to be what is bringing it back.

Booting with splash removed from the grub command line produces
continuing video output without this flicker, though no script for
logging output with plymouth produces output during this time (as my
scripts normally would on console).

Thus, it seems that either plymouth needs to be patched to adapt to the
/run changes, or that there is a problem elsewhere concerning video
devices during this transition.
